- 1、本文档共43页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
PAGE37/NUMPAGES43
弹性伸缩策略研究
TOC\o1-3\h\z\u
第一部分弹性伸缩定义 2
第二部分伸缩策略分类 7
第三部分触发机制分析 10
第四部分资源调度模型 18
第五部分性能优化方法 21
第六部分成本控制策略 28
第七部分实施挑战分析 32
第八部分未来发展趋势 37
第一部分弹性伸缩定义
关键词
关键要点
弹性伸缩的基本概念
1.弹性伸缩是一种自动化资源管理技术,通过动态调整计算资源以适应应用负载变化,确保系统性能和成本效益。
2.其核心在于基于预设规则或智能算法,实时监测并响应业务需求,实现资源的自动增减。
3.该技术广泛应用于云计算和微服务架构,支持按需扩展,提升系统弹性和可用性。
弹性伸缩的工作原理
1.弹性伸缩通过监控指标(如CPU使用率、请求量)触发伸缩事件,执行预定义的伸缩策略。
2.支持手动和自动两种模式,自动模式下可集成机器学习模型,预测负载趋势优化伸缩决策。
3.伸缩过程涉及资源池管理、实例生命周期控制和跨区域负载均衡,确保平滑过渡。
弹性伸缩的应用场景
1.适用于高流量业务(如电商促销、直播平台),通过快速扩容应对瞬时负载峰值。
2.支持多租户环境,实现资源隔离和按使用量付费的精细化成本控制。
3.与无服务器架构协同,动态分配函数实例,降低冷启动损耗。
弹性伸缩的关键技术
1.基于容器编排的Kubernetes可编程伸缩,支持声明式资源管理。
2.异构资源调度技术,整合计算、存储、网络等多维度资源协同伸缩。
3.边缘计算的引入,使伸缩策略向终端延伸,降低延迟并提升响应速度。
弹性伸缩的优化方向
1.预测性伸缩通过历史数据分析,提前储备资源,减少抖动影响。
2.绿色伸缩技术,结合能耗模型,在扩容时优先使用清洁能源。
3.多目标优化算法(如NSGA-II)平衡性能、成本与公平性。
弹性伸缩的挑战与趋势
1.复杂场景下的策略冲突(如安全与性能),需引入多约束决策模型。
2.边缘云融合推动分布式伸缩,需解决跨地域数据一致性问题。
3.零信任架构下,伸缩策略需动态适配安全边界,确保合规性。
在云计算和分布式系统领域,弹性伸缩(ElasticScaling)是一种关键的自动化机制,旨在根据应用程序的实时负载需求动态调整计算资源。这种机制通过自动增加或减少资源,确保系统在高峰期能够维持性能,在低谷期则能够降低成本,从而实现资源利用率和成本效益的平衡。弹性伸缩的核心思想在于自动化地管理计算资源,以适应不断变化的业务需求,这一概念已成为现代云服务和微服务架构中的重要组成部分。
弹性伸缩的定义可以从多个维度进行阐述。首先,从技术层面来看,弹性伸缩是一种基于自动化策略的资源管理方法,通过监控系统负载、资源使用情况和其他相关指标,自动触发资源的增加或减少。这种自动化过程通常依赖于云服务提供商的API接口、虚拟机管理平台或第三方监控工具。通过预设的规则和阈值,系统可以在检测到资源不足或过剩时,自动启动新的虚拟机实例或关闭闲置的实例,从而实现资源的动态调配。
在具体实现中,弹性伸缩通常涉及以下几个关键组件:首先是监控机制,用于实时收集系统性能数据,如CPU使用率、内存占用、网络流量和响应时间等。其次是决策引擎,根据预设的策略和规则分析监控数据,判断是否需要调整资源。最后是执行器,负责实际执行资源的增加或减少操作,如启动虚拟机、终止实例或调整容器数量。这些组件协同工作,形成一个闭环的自动伸缩系统,确保资源始终处于最优状态。
从业务层面来看,弹性伸缩的定义更加注重其对业务连续性和成本控制的影响。在传统IT架构中,系统资源的配置往往基于历史峰值进行静态规划,这可能导致在业务低谷期资源闲置,而在高峰期则出现资源不足的情况。弹性伸缩通过动态调整资源,避免了这种静态配置的局限性,使得系统能够更加灵活地应对业务波动。例如,在电商促销活动期间,系统可以根据实时流量自动增加服务器数量,确保用户请求得到及时处理;而在促销结束后,系统则可以自动缩减资源,降低运营成本。
在数据充分性和专业性的方面,弹性伸缩的效果通常通过一系列量化指标进行评估。这些指标包括但不限于资源利用率、响应时间、系统吞吐量和成本节约率。通过对比传统静态配置和弹性伸缩的运行数据,可以直观地展示弹性伸缩的优势。例如,某电商平台的实验数据显示,在促销高峰期,弹性伸缩使系统吞吐量提升了30%,同时将响应时间缩短了20%,而运营成本则降低了15%。这些数据充分
您可能关注的文档
最近下载
- 波司登MSP检核专项考核及服务销售相关知识试卷.docx
- 第十七届全国大学生先进成图技术与产品信息建模创新大赛——全国总决赛赛题(建筑类).pdf VIP
- 《外科护理学肺部疾病》授课表.doc VIP
- 《GB13495.1-2015消防安全标志第1部分:标志》最新解读.pptx VIP
- 2025年(完整word版)体育单招英语试题与附标准答案 .pdf VIP
- 部编版三年级上册第一单元作业设计.pptx VIP
- 建筑地基基础工程施工规范完整版2024.pdf VIP
- 榆林能源集团有限公司招聘工作人员考试真题2024.docx VIP
- 整车座椅的设计开发方法与流程.pptx VIP
- GB50864-2013 尾矿设施施工及验收规范.docx VIP
文档评论(0)